Output 45aafc003663eb94e938ce221377070c4c27f200f6cbf02559e7a9447119931b:0

value
11021567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f1385d99af090e5a227a714ecacce582c1cbe85 OP_EQUAL
address
3BpLKJqrbZ1XUf5BHbHnvZMk9w5JXMq1U4
transaction
45aafc003663eb94e938ce221377070c4c27f200f6cbf02559e7a9447119931b
spent
true